The reason I decided to do a Travel Blog was because I wanted more than just pictures of my travels.  Going travelling is more than just booking a flight and accommodation, and since I am taking an unspecified length sabbatical I wanted to include preparation and most importantly my stated of mind and thoughts whilst travelling, hence a Travel Blog.  This is the first website I’ve ever done and historically I’m kept my personal life very private so this is a step out of my comfort zone…which I thought would be a good way to learn about myself.

I’ve always wanted to explore and love history so what better way to satisfy these passions by travelling and along the way make some changes to my life.
